It’s interesting that the sharp fall in traffic mimics the fall of Twitter and Reddit.
Anecdotally, I would find code answrs on Reddit or Twitter, that would direct to Stack to view the full answer, or a more complete explanation of why X should be done that way.
Considering the (relatively) small decline, I’m surprised that Stack think the answer is ChatGPT(or similar), and not the loss of semantic details added by a Reddit/Twitter thread.
